Healthy is the subject of 1,096 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 225 of them currently open to new participants. 43 are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 546 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most active sponsor is Eli Lilly and Company, running 55 of these trials.

Key findings
What ClinicalTrials.gov does not surface for Healthy on its own pages , computed from the registry mirror as of 2026-07-11. Each line carries its own denominator so it can be quoted as it stands.
-
Healthy is recruiting below its size-band peers.
225 of 1,096 indexed trials (20.5%) are open to enrollment, against a 37.2% average across 135 conditions with 100+ trials. The peer set uses the same ClinicalTrials.gov-derived counts as this page.
-
Sponsorship of Healthy trials is spread across many organizations.
Eli Lilly and Company accounts for 55 of 1,096 trials (5%). 429 distinct sponsors appear on at least one study for this condition label.
-
Most Healthy trials plan to enrol fewer than 100 people.
Median target enrolment is 40 among the 1,091 trials that report a genuine target (sentinel values excluded). 851 of those (78%) plan for fewer than 100 participants.
-
Healthy research is mostly interventional.
905 interventional and 191 observational studies make up this index (82.6% interventional). Study type is sponsor-reported on ClinicalTrials.gov.

How open-enrollment share is computed
Open share is recruiting_count divided by trial_count for this condition label in the public registry export. Status can change between pulls; treat the figure as a snapshot of research attention, not treatment availability.
